Is the 2011 Audi A5 expensive to repair?

The average annual repair cost is $887 which means it has higher than average ownership costs. Repairs are more frequent for the A5 Quattro, so you may experience a few more visits to your Audi shop than normal. Is the Audi A5 2011 a good car?

The 2011 Audi A5 handles well, with impressive body control and tenacious traction from the all-wheel-drive system. It’s important to remember that the A5 weighs more than its rear-wheel-drive rivals, which largely explains why the car feels more like a grand touring coupe than a high-performance one.
